Compact Digital Camera FS30 – 28mm Wide-angle 8x Optical Zoom LUMIX DC Lens and iA (Intelligent Auto) Mode with Advanced Scene Detection. In iA (Intelligent Auto) Mode, 4 detection functions work automatically and simultaneously to optimize your settings, making it easier than ever to take beautiful photos every time. The DMC-FS30 can record motion pictures in high-definition (1,280 x 720 pixels at 30 fps in Motion JPEG format). The pixel mixed readout method enables bright motion-picture recording even in low-light settings. The DMC-FS30 can also record stunning full-size motion pictures in WVGA (848 x 480 pixels at 30 fps) or standard motion pictures in VGA (640 x 480 pixels at 30 fps) and QVGA (320 x 240 pixels at 30 fps)…. more >>

I bought this product and am impressed by its quality. Its taking me a while to get used to it’s focussing settings but overall I’m pleased with the product. However I wouldn’t recommend this camera for music festivals, or anything where it could easily get knocked or damaged as the door which holds the memory card and battery in is very flimsy and easily comes loose. The door does have a locking mechanism, but it is so delicate that one simple knock while taking a photo or carrying it and I’m finding the door coming loose. Which is quite dissapointing. I would expect the door to be more robust.
